The blind contessa's new machine

Carolina Fantoni, a young contessa in nineteenth century Italy, is going blind. But nobody believes her, neither her parents nor her fiance. Only her friend Turri, the eccentric local inventory, understands. Losing her sight isolates Carolina. Even writing letters with pen and ink proves almost impossible, until Turri invents a new machine: the world's first typewriter. His gift ignites a passionate love affair that will mark both of their lives forever.
